If you belong to a band and love the art of your job, but sing the blues when it comes to the business, you need Music Law. Composed by musician and lawyer Richard Stim, the book explains how to:
book performances
choose a name and protect its use
copyright song lyrics
establish legal ownership of songs
sample legally
sign contracts
write a band partnership agreement
sell CDs, tapes and other recordings
and much more
Music Law provides all the legal information and practical advice musicians need. The 3rd edition includes all sorts of new information on band insurance and liability, parodies of trademarks in songs, changes in webcasting rules, the number of permissions needed for sampling, new rules on tax deductions -- and much more!
All the legal forms and agreements musicians need are included as tear-outs and on CD-ROM.
